Transaction 5827206b64150af17f5c753273575666daf69b76fe848d0c4fa2bce3605e8e62

7 Input
2 Outputs
  • 5827206b64150af17f5c753273575666daf69b76fe848d0c4fa2bce3605e8e62:0
  • value  715142
    address  1PzM9gojinPs6a7rczm6ThCphAbUXcwUXV
  • 5827206b64150af17f5c753273575666daf69b76fe848d0c4fa2bce3605e8e62:1
  • value  140000000
    address  1MPZaFtha4r4s3ehnDP5R4hWbrp6ocfjsv